Hey folks, quick heads-up for everyone new to the Marblewren platform team: we rotated credentials this morning as part of the quarterly sweep. Reminder that our dependency pinning policy still applies — exact versions only, no ranges, and bump them via a reviewed PR. The old resolver key stops working Friday. Until your personal creds are provisioned, use the shared one below.

service key, fawip-bajef: kto11_Qt5wZK9vdNC

// Client setup for the Pagesmith incremental rebuild service.
// When content editors publish in Quillbase, a webhook marks the
// affected routes dirty; this client asks Pagesmith to rebuild only
// those routes rather than the whole site. Note the retry policy:
// rebuilds are idempotent, so we retry aggressively on 5xx but never
// on 4xx, which usually indicates a stale route manifest.
// The client authenticates to Pagesmith with the internal key below.

gateway credential: kto3_qfe

## Introduce per-tenant rate quotas in the Orvane gateway

For the release manager: this change replaces our global throttle with per-tenant quotas, resolved at request time from the tenant registry and cached for sixty seconds. Tenants without an explicit quota inherit the tier default; overage returns a retryable status with a hint header. Rollout is gated behind a flag, defaulting off, and the old throttle remains as a backstop until two clean release cycles pass.

The initial tier defaults we intend to ship are listed below.

limits module of taguf-hafog:
WEIGHTS = {
    "wenox": 690,
    "wenok": 782,
    "kelax": 41,
    "holox": 338,
    "quenir": 39,
}

## Timing-Chip Reader: Who to Ping

If the ChronoStride reader acts up during a release cut — dropped reads, weird sync drift, firmware refusing to flash — don't debug it yourself. The Trackside Hardware crew at Lanyard Labs owns the whole reader stack, including the gate antennas at the Pinefield course. They're quick on weekdays. Send them a short note with logs attached.

escalation mailbox, hadug-bajog: sormir@norvalabs.internal